Commercial storage units for sale in San Nicolás de los Garza Centro
2 results
Commercial Storage Unit in San Nicolás de los Garza Centro, San Nicolás de los Garza
1,360 m²
Commercial Storage Unit in San Nicolás de los Garza Centro, San Nicolás de los Garza
562 m²

Page 1 of 1